This example shows how to use the virtual keyboard in a Qt Quick application.
The example has two implementations: one for desktop platforms and another for embedded platforms. The former version enables text input into several text fields using the virtual keyboard, whereas the latter version uses the same UI but with a custom virtual keyboard
InputPanel
. The following snippet from
basic.pro
shows how the qmake project is set up to choose the appropriate implementation based on the CONFIG options:
!qtConfig(vkb-desktop) { DEFINES += MAIN_QML=\\\"basic-b2qt.qml\\\" } else { DEFINES += MAIN_QML=\\\"Basic.qml\\\" }
The example enables the virtual keyboard by setting the
QT_IM_MODULE
environment variable before loading the
.qml
文件:
#include <QQuickView> #include <QGuiApplication> #include <QQmlEngine> int main(int argc, char *argv[]) { qputenv("QT_IM_MODULE", QByteArray("qtvirtualkeyboard")); QGuiApplication app(argc, argv); QQuickView view(QString("qrc:/%2").arg(MAIN_QML)); if (view.status() == QQuickView::Error) return -1; view.setResizeMode(QQuickView::SizeRootObjectToView); view.show(); return app.exec(); }
Besides this, it uses custom TextField and TextArea items to configure the [ENTER] key behavior using the EnterKeyAction attached property.
import QtQuick import QtQuick.Controls import QtQuick.VirtualKeyboard import "content" Rectangle { ... TextField { width: parent.width placeholderText: "One line field" enterKeyAction: EnterKeyAction.Next onAccepted: passwordField.focus = true } ... TextArea { id: textArea width: parent.width placeholderText: "Multiple line field" height: Math.max(206, implicitHeight) } }
The
TextField
and
TextArea
controls extend the respective
Qt Quick Controls 2
types with
enterKeyEnabled
and
enterKeyAction
properties. The
TextField
and
TextArea
instances in the snippet can set these properties to change the default behavior.
